Output 6bb2a39eec1ecdb45e060ba1b059bf6ec015bd27864fc3357486ce0288ea2345:12

value
1277511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c8d224f8150280307d005af06d9cd52ec013ce OP_EQUAL
address
34meo9qtiC5qrBBcMtvBU6emuHBjuaSTFM
transaction
6bb2a39eec1ecdb45e060ba1b059bf6ec015bd27864fc3357486ce0288ea2345
confirmations
318202
spent
true